The Albert Memorial Chapel, Windsor, c1900. Albert Memorial Chapel, built by Henry VII as a royal mausoleum, was restored by Queen Victoria and named in memory of her consort. From Sights and Scenes in England and Wales. [Cassell and Company Ltd., c1900]
